> Gábor Stefanik wrote:
>>
>> On http://bu3sch.de/gitweb?p=b43-tools.git;a=blob;f=fwcutter/fwcutter_list.h;hb=HEAD,
>> it doesn't look like v4.150.10.5 contains rev16 - there is one version
>> that does have it, but the link to that file is dead.
>
> The rev 16 firmware definitely is in driver 4.174.64.19, but not in
> 4.150.10.5. I'll have to figure out where I got it, and what
> modifications are needed in fwcutter to make it available.
>
> I suggest that you do the mods to the firmware loading. If Broadcom
> has it in their driver, there must be hardware that needs it.
>
> Larry
I would say that's a goal for later - the FIFO sizes are different, so
it would clearly need more work than just loading the firmware to
support rev16 devices.
